Worth knowing

Chimney sweep logs do not sweep chimneys. They loosen some creosote - which then falls where a brush and vacuum still have to collect it.

How Olympia Chimney Products Fail - and How We Fix Them

  • Olympia Chimney stainless steel liners and creosote glaze. The 316L liner in Olympia Chimney’s stainless systems holds up well, but in North Bergen’s damp, cold winters we regularly see third-degree creosote forming faster than on clay tile because the smooth steel surface cools quickly between burns. That glaze is not a brush job. We remove it with a rotary whip designed for steel liners so the surface isn’t scored, then we show you the before-and-after on camera.
  • Olympia Chimney Terra Cotta flue tiles and spalling. The Terra Cotta series is a solid product, but North Bergen’s freeze-thaw cycles get water behind the tile face and cause spalling, where thin chunks flake off into the flue. During a sweep we catch that early. Left alone, spalled pieces wedge against the damper and restrict draft. We clear the blockages and tell you if the tile is still sound or needs a HeatShield resurfacing.
  • Olympia Chimney caps and animal entry. The factory Olympia Chimney cap does its job, but we pull more squirrel and raccoon nests out of North Bergen chimneys than anywhere else in the county. The mesh on older Olympia Chimney caps corrodes at the seam after five or six seasons, and that opening is all a squirrel needs. We clean the nesting material out, check the cap, and replace it with a stainless cap sized to your flue, not a universal-fit piece.
  • Olympia Chimney dampers and hidden soot ledges. The cast-iron top-sealing damper on Olympia Chimney systems has a ledge just above the firebox where soot collects and hardens. Most sweeps miss it because you can’t see it from below. We go up top and clean that ledge by hand during every sweep. If your fire has been sluggish or smoke backs up on cold starts, that ledge is usually the reason.
  • Olympia Chimney prefab air-cooled pipe and creosote catching on seams. On North Bergen homes with Olympia Chimney’s air-cooled prefab chimney pipe, we see creosote building at the inner pipe seams first. The seam acts like a shelf in the flue. Our brushes are sized to the pipe’s interior dimension so we don’t over-scrub and damage the refractory, but we get into those seam lines thoroughly. That seam buildup is a chimney fire risk, and a standard six-inch brush from a big-box store won’t touch it.
